An empirical study of an informal knowledge repository in a medium-sized software consulting company

Numerous studies have been conducted on design and architecture of knowledge repositories. This paper addresses the need for looking at practices where knowledge repositories are actually used in concrete work situations. This insight should be used when developing knowledge repositories in the future. Through methods inspired by ethnography this paper investigates how an unstructured knowledge repository is used for different purposes by software developers and managers in a medium-sized software consulting company. The repository is a part of the company's knowledge management tool suite on the Intranet. We found five distinct ways of using the tool, from solving specific technical problems to getting an overview of competence in the company. We highlight the importance of informal organization and the social integration of the tool in the daily work practices of the company.

[1]  Rudy L. Ruggles,et al.  Knowledge Management Tools , 1996 .

[2]  Douglas R. Skuce,et al.  Knowledge management in software design: a tool and a trial , 1995, Softw. Eng. J..

[3]  Frank Bomarius,et al.  Learning software organizations : methodology and applications : 11th International Conference on Software Engineering and Knowledge Engineering, SEKE '99, Kaiserslautern, Germany, June 16-19, 1999 : proceedings , 2000 .

[4]  Victor R. Basili,et al.  The software engineering laboratory - an operational software experience factory , 1992, International Conference on Software Engineering.

[5]  Gertjan van Heijst,et al.  Corporate memories as a tool for knowledge management , 1997 .

[6]  Frank Houdek,et al.  Establishing experience factories at Daimler-Benz an experience report , 1998, Proceedings of the 20th International Conference on Software Engineering.

[7]  David M. Fetterman,et al.  Ethnography: Step-by-Step , 1989 .

[8]  Einar Dehli,et al.  Knowledge Sharing in Distributed Organisations , 2002 .

[9]  C. Ruppel,et al.  Sharing knowledge through intranets: a study of organizational culture and intranet implementation , 2001 .

[10]  A. Strauss,et al.  Basics of Qualitative Research , 1992 .

[11]  Thomas H. Davenport,et al.  Book review:Working knowledge: How organizations manage what they know. Thomas H. Davenport and Laurence Prusak. Harvard Business School Press, 1998. $29.95US. ISBN 0‐87584‐655‐6 , 1998 .

[12]  Torgeir Dingsøyr,et al.  Knowledge Management in Medium-Sized Software Consulting Companies , 2002, Empirical Software Engineering.

[13]  Morten T. Hansen,et al.  What's your strategy for managing knowledge? , 1999, Harvard business review.

[14]  Andreas Jedlitschka,et al.  The Integrated Corporate Information Network iCoIN: A Comprehensive, Web-Based Experience Factory , 2001, LSO.

[15]  J. Liebowitz,et al.  Knowledge Organizations: What Every Manager Should Know , 1998 .

[16]  Reidar Conradi,et al.  A Survey of Case Studies of the Use of Knowledge Management in Software Engineering , 2002, Int. J. Softw. Eng. Knowl. Eng..

[17]  Patrick A. V. Hall,et al.  "Talk to Paula and Peter - They Are Experienced" - The Experience Engine in a Nutshell , 1999, SEKE.

[18]  Scott Henninger,et al.  Case-Based Knowledge Management Tools for Software Development , 1997, Automated Software Engineering.

[19]  M. Lindvall,et al.  Knowledge management in software engineering , 2002, IEEE Software.

[20]  R. Ruggles,et al.  Tools for Knowledge Management: An Introduction , 1996 .

[21]  Art Kleiner,et al.  Car Launch: The Human Side of Managing Change , 1999 .

[22]  Torgeir Dingsøyr,et al.  Skills Management as Knowledge Technology in a Software Consultancy Company , 2001, LSO.

[23]  Remo Pareschi,et al.  Information Technology for Knowledge Management , 1998, Springer Berlin Heidelberg.

[24]  Egil Wulff Living organizational myths and the broadening of opportunity structures for knowledge sharing in a Scandinavian engineering consultant company , 2002 .

[25]  Robert S. Taylor,et al.  Information use environments. , 1991 .

[26]  Victor R. Basili,et al.  Experience in Implementing a Learning Software Organization , 2002, IEEE Softw..